Hippolyte François Moreau was a French sculptor famous for his bronze statuettes of young women. Born in Diijon France as the son of the renound sculptor Jean-Baptiste Moreau, he grew up learning from his father’s work shop. He moved to Paris to study further under Francois Jouffroy at the École Nationale Superienre des Beaux-Arts, first exhibiting at the Salon of French artists in 1863 and continuing to show work there until 1914.
 
In both 1878 and 1900 he won medals for his work, large scale such as vases and statuettes at the university Exbosition in Paris. One of his noteable sculptures is his 1880 statue of the celebrated French mathematician Alexis Clairaut, which now occupies one of the facades of city hall Paris. He died in 1927 in France and today his works are collected in the museum of fine arts in Diijon.
